23andMe’s Bankruptcy: Is your DNA at risk? How its collapse could impact your data security
Genetic testing company 23andMe has fil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y, a move that raises questions for its millions of customers. The firm, which revolutionised at-home DNA testing, announced on Sunday that it was seeking a sale to address its financial troubles. With over 15 million customers who have provided genetic data, many are now asking: What happens to their sensitive information? The company’s struggles come after years of failed attempts to develop a profitable business model. While it once seemed destined for success, 23andMe failed to convert one-time customers into regular subscribers. This lack of sustained engagement led to its downfall, making its data valuable to potential buyers.

Amazon's robotaxi unit Zoox agrees recall over braking issue
Amazon's self-driving unit Zoox agreed to recall 258 vehicles due to issues with its automated driving system that could cause unexpected hard braking, after a US investigation, according to a company filing Wednesday. The recall affects vehicles equipped with self-driving software versions released before November 5. The California-based company said it has addressed the issue by updating the software on the company-owned vehicles. In May,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ration opened a probe into self-driving Zoox vehicles due to unexpected braking leading to two rear-end collisions that injured motorcyclists.

Savage Pet recalls some of its products in these states over fears of bird flu contamination
Savage Pet has recalled some products that are feared to be contaminated with bird flu. Savage Pet is in the process of recalling several boxes of cat food chicken from a specific lot as it may contain H5N1, or the bird flu, according to the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The brand is recalling 66 of its 84-oz Large Chicken Boxes and 74 of its 21-oz Small Chicken Boxes bearing the lot code/expiration date «11152026», the FDA said in a press release.

Two NASA astronauts, one Japanese, and one Russian: Meet NASA's new crew to ISS to bring back Sunita Williams and Butch Willmore
Butch Wilmore and Suni Williams, who have been stuck on the orbital lab for nine months. NASA’s SpaceX Crew-10 mission lifted off at 7:03 p.m. EDT on Friday from Launch Complex 39A at Kennedy Space Center in Florida, carrying four astronauts to the International Space Station (ISS). The Crew-10 team will spend approximately six months aboard the station. The crew members include NASA astronauts Anne McClain and Nichole Ayers, Japanese astronaut Takuya Onishi, and Russian cosmonaut Kirill Peskov. As their mission mascot, the astronauts selected a crocheted origami crane—a symbol of unity. Highlighting the crew's international diversity, McClain expressed their shared vision: «Crew-10 chooses to go together in peace because you cannot be great without the greatness of others,» she said.

Harvard, Yale, Columbia fall in line after Trump funding threats
Harvard University terminated a librarian this month who ripped down a poster of Israeli hostages at a pro-Palestine rally, while Yale University’s law school placed a pro-Palestinian research scholar on leave over allegations that she has ties to a group subject to US sanctions. At Cornell University, a group called Students for Justice in Palestine faces suspension after disrupting a “Pathways for Peace” event on campus this week, and the University of California at Los Angeles —- rocked last year by anti-Zionist rallies and accusations of mistreatment of Jewish students — created a new initiative to combat antisemitism. Columbia University, the scene of some of the most dramatic protests against Israel last year, said the school will transform its approach to managing demonstrations.
